With this La Crosse Technology internet-powered wireless forecaster, one no longer needs to watch the TV weather reporter recite the weather for every corner of the county to hear one\'s local forecast. Not only does the Weather Direct WD-2513U two-day forecaster provide free internet forecasts transmitted directly to its display, but it also relays the outdoor temperature from right outside the front door with the included TX-50U wireless sensor. An included AC-powered gateway connects with a secure LAN cable to a network router for internet forecasts. Upon online registration, the user chooses forecasts from over 60,000 US and Canadian locations to view on the display.
The display stands alone or wall hangs. The selected location, location forecast, sunrise and sunset times, and outdoor temperature scroll across the bottom LCD section; four scrolling speeds are available. In the center LCD section, forecast icons and projected high and low temperatures are posted, updating every six hours. The top section displays the internet-set time and indoor temperature. Using the simple four-button interface, users view four additional micro forecasts daily: morning, afternoon, evening, and night. The buttons also enable date display, LCD contrast adjustments, Fahrenheit/Celsius selection, and alarm setting. Communicating with the display from up to 330 feet unobstructed, both the gateway and the outdoor sensor come with mounting hardware. For the best results, install the sensor out of direct rain and sunlight. No additional software or Wi-Fi connection is required, nor does the computer need to be on for forecaster operation. However, the system does necessitate high-speed internet service, a network router, and the separate purchase of three AAA and two AA batteries. A limited one-year warranty covers the forecaster.
